当前位置:首页 » 编程语言 » sql从小到大排序
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ql从小到大排序

发布时间: 2022-03-30 17:19:24

1. 用sql写出: 求每一年龄上人数超过2的男生的具体人数,并按年龄从小到大排序 (表为student)

很高兴回答你的问题
根据你的要求,SQL如下:
select age,count(*) from student s where s.sex='男生' group by age having count(*) >2 order by age;
having count(*) >2 表示只查询男生中每一年龄的人数大于2的
如有疑问,请Hi我!谢谢!

2. SQL 能先从小到大排序后在进行最小最大,最2小最2大,最小最3大…… 一次类推吗

with
orderasc as ( select id,lh,row_number() over(order by lh) as rc from biao_a ),
orderdesc as ( select id,lh,row_number() over(order by lh desc) as rc from biao_a ),
mix as ( select id,lh,rc from orderasc union all select id,lh,rc from orderdesc order by rc,id ),
counts as ( select count(1) as rowcounts from mix )
select id, lh from mix,counts where rownum <= rowcounts/2;

3. sql怎么根据字段长度和大小排序

可以参考下面的代码:

select * from 表 order by len(字段);长度,由短到长

select * from 表 order by len(字段)desc;长度,由长到短

select * from 表 order by 字段;大小,由小到大

select * from 表 order by 字段 desc;大小,由大到小

(3)sql从小到大排序扩展阅读:

sql参考语句

更新:update table1 set field1=value1 where 范围

排序:select * from table1 order by field1,field2 [desc]

求和:select sum(field1) as sumvalue from table1

平均:select avg(field1) as avgvalue from table1

4. SQL按某个字段值相同的记录数从小到大查询排序

这个是可以实现的,但直接实现比较复杂,
可以借助于辅助的一列来简单的实现,
1.就是可以加一列,用来记录与本行中B字段内容相同的记录条数,
使用update语句将新增加的一列进行更新,
2.然后在使用排序,首先对新增加的列进行升序排列,还可以继续在新增加的列内容相同的基础上按照别的字段进行排序,
呵呵,希望能有帮助,^_^

5. sql数据库查询出来的数据从大到小排序

利用order by进行排序,降序(从大到写)可以用desc,升序(从小到大)是默认的

6. 用SQL server写:查询结果按总课时从小到大排序(升序)

SELECT * FROM tb_name ORDER BY 课时 ASC

7. 请问SQL SERVER 怎样先从小到大排序然后再分页

select top 600 from table where id > (
select max(id) from (
select top (600*pageNum) id from table order by id
) innerTable
) outterTable

600*pageNum这个值需要你在程序里算好。就是页码*每页的600条

8. 数据库按从小到大的顺序排列sql怎么写

select
top
10
from
表名
order
by
排序列
desc;
sql的执行顺序先按照你的要求排序,然后才返回查询的内容。例如有一个名为id自动增长的列,表中有100条数据,列的值得分别是1、2、3、4………9、99、100。那么查询加了desc你得到的是91到100条,就是最后十条,如果加asc你得到的将会是1到10,也就是最前面的那几条。

9. 如何用数据库sql把一列数据从大到小排列

select * from 表名 order by 要排列的字段 desc。

10. SQL 字符串按大小排序

没有这个SQL语句.
你这个不是字段的排序,
是字段里面的值排序后重新展示.

数据库只是存储数据,不处理数据的.
只有你代码来处理字段值的排序.split一下,然后排序,然后输出.